What the numbers mean in Cherryvale city
Housing cost measured against local earnings.
A household earning the Cherryvale city median would spend about 17.4% of gross income on the median rent. The 30% mark is the federal threshold for cost burden, so anything above it signals a stretched rental market. The median home costs 1.1× the median household income; nationally that ratio sits near 4.5×. Poverty affects 19% of residents and 62% of households own their home.
Source: US Census Bureau, ACS 2019-2023 5-year estimates · rates as published for 2019-2023 ACS 5-year
